EVERLAST TO SPONSOR ICONIC LEGACY EVENT IN DUBAI

PhilBoxing.com




D4G Promotions is thrilled to announce that Everlast will be the title sponsor for the prestigious #Legacy event in Dubai this weekend - as Jamel Herring defends his WBO super-featherweight title against Carl Frampton.

The highly-anticipated, first ever world title fight to be held in the Middle East, takes place at Caesars Bluewaters Dubai on April 3, and will now feature one of the biggest sports brands in the world.

Everlast has been synonymous with boxing for generations, worn by all of the greats throughout the years, including the likes of Muhammad Ali, Marvin Hagler, Sugar Ray Leonard, Roberto Duran, Joe Frazier and many more.

The brand has established itself as the boxing industry’s market leader, providing a wide range of elite products that includes gloves, sports equipment, clothing and footwear.

Having announced a historic pledge to British boxing last week – a commitment to sign 52 new fighters this year – today’s sponsorship news is yet another bold statement of Everlast’s dedication to boxing.

Everlast will now be involved in April's groundbreaking event, as Frampton looks to become the island of Ireland's first ever three-weight world champion when he challenges American hero Herring.

Elsewhere on the card, Zhankosh Turarov and Tyrone McKenna meet for the WBO Intercontinental super-lightweight title, boxing legend and former four-weight world champion Donnie Nietes faces Pablo Carrillo for the vacant WBO International super-flyweight title, Kazakhstan sensation Tursynbay Kulakhmet defends his WBC International super-welterweight title against 20-0 opponent Heber Rondon, and American prodigy Keyshawn Davis returns.
